What is GHK-Cu / Copper Peptide?

Copper peptide (GHK-Cu) is a naturally occurring compound your body produces to repair and regenerate itself. It
was first identified in human plasma in 1973 and has since become one of the most researched anti-aging actives
in modern dermatology, with 50+ years of peer-reviewed studies backing its effectiveness.
Most skincare ingredients work on the surface, but copper peptide works differently. It signals your cells to behave
younger. It activates the genes responsible for collagen and elastin production, accelerates cellular repair,
strengthens hair follicles at the root, and switches off the inflammatory pathways that speed up visible aging —
genuinely rebuilding your skin and hair at a molecular level.

Copper peptide has exploded in popularity — but most brands are getting it wrong in three specific ways:

  1. Incompatible formulations. GHK-Cu breaks down when combined with vitamin C, AHAs like glycolic acid,
    chelating agents, and low pH ingredients. Many brands are mixing these together, rendering the copper
    peptide inactive before it even reaches your skin.
  2. Wrong concentrations. Research identifies a clear optimal dosage window. Too little and it does not work. Too much causes adverse effects and costs more than it needs to. Many brands overclaim concentration purely for marketing impact — ignoring what the science actually calls for.
  3. Dishonest pricing. A genuinely high-concentration GHK-Cu formula is expensive to produce. If the price
    does not match the claim, you do not know what is actually in the bottle.

Why is the product blue?

The distinctive blue color comes from the GHK-Cu complex itself — copper peptide naturally produces a blue hue when the copper ion bonds with the peptide chain. It is not artificial dye or added color. What you are seeing is the active ingredient at work. The more concentrated the formula, the deeper the blue.
